Como configuro várias suítes no Reprepro?

5

Eu quero um repositório privado do apt para pacotes lúcidos estáveis e instáveis. Eu continuo recebendo um erro quando tento incluir um debian.

Multiple distributions with the common codename: 'lucid'!
First was in ./conf/distributions line 1 to 8, another in lines 10 to 17There have been errors!

Estou usando este arquivo de configuração.

Origin: Stable Repository
Label: Stable Repository
Suite: stable
Codename: lucid
Architectures: i386 amd64
Components: main non-free
Description: Stable Repository
SignWith: yes

Origin: Unstable Repository
Label: Unstable Repository
Suite: unstable
Codename: lucid
Architectures: i386 amd64
Components: main non-free
Description: Unstable Repository
SignWith: yes

O que há de errado com meu arquivo de configuração?

    
por GregB 06.02.2013 / 17:53

2 respostas

3

Como a mensagem de erro diz, você tem o mesmo codinome em ambos os conjuntos, o que não é possível. Você teria que chamar o segundo algo como "lúcido-instável". Isso é semelhante ao que o repositório oficial faz com atualizações lúcidas, propostas lúcidas, lucid-backports, etc.

    
por Neil Mayhew 16.05.2013 / 20:48
2

Eu nunca percebi isso com o reprepro, mas descobri o Freight, o que torna o gerenciamento do repositório Debian muito mais fácil do que com o reprepro.

link

    
por GregB 08.02.2013 / 19:46

Tags